Transaction 3d594e40632545f592c77567ccdb3d893ddb8b835b58a59e981a7d295e0a0423
1 Input
1 Output
-
3d594e40632545f592c77567ccdb3d893ddb8b835b58a59e981a7d295e0a0423:0
- value
- 1302314
- script pubkey
- OP_0 OP_PUSHBYTES_20 56274326b40403fd434b9bbc651b3b3fefb44a6a
- address
- bc1q2cn5xf45qspl6s6tnw7x2xem8lhmgjn2aj2mzv